Dicliptera resupinata (Vahl) Juss. is a plant in the Acanthaceae family, order Lamiales, kingdom Plantae. Not known to be toxic.

Dicliptera resupinata is an herb that grows up to 61 cm tall, flowering from spring through early fall.
